The Brooklyn Women’s Bar Association hosted its third annual Hispanic Heritage Month celebration at the Brooklyn Bar Association building on Wednesday night. This year’s theme was “Unidos: Inclusivity for a Stronger Nation.”
The event, which was co-sponsored by the Kings County Criminal Bar Association, featured a speech by New York City Councilmember Alexa Avilés and featured a musical and dance performance by Juan Cartagena and the Segunda Quimbamba Folklore Center.
